Commercial Slab Installation in Spartanburg, SC

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of business and industrial projects. These services typically cover the construction of large, flat concrete surfaces such as warehouse floors, retail store fo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and other flat surfaces essential for commercial properties. Property owners often seek this service to ensure a durable, level base that can support heavy equipment, foot traffic, or vehicle loads, making it a vital step in the development or renovation of commercial spaces.

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ation requirements, concrete thickness, and reinforcement methods. It's also important to consider factors like drainage, access for construction equipment, and any local building codes or permits that may apply. Clear communication about these details helps ensure the project meets the specific needs of the property and provides a long-lasting foundation for future use.

FAQ

Commercial Slab Installation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or storage areas on commercial properties.

How thick should a commercial concrete slab be? The thickness varies based on the load requirements, typically ranging from 4 to 8 inches for most commercial applications.

What factors influence the durability of a commercial slab? Proper soil preparation, quality of materials, and appropriate reinforcement help ensure the slab's durability and longevity.

Is reinforcement necessary for a commercial slab installation? Reinforcement, such as steel rebar or mesh, is commonly used to prevent cracking and support heavy loads.
